PEOPLE EX REL. WORDELL v. CITY OF CHICAGO

No. 77-296.

67 Ill. App.3d 321 (1978)

384 N.E.2d 894

THE PEOPLE ex rel. ROBERT T. WORDELL et al., Plaintiffs-Appellees, v. THE CITY OF CHICAGO et al., Defendants-Appellants.

Appellate Court of Illinois — First District (3rd Division).

Opinion filed December 13, 1978.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

William R. Quinlan, Corporation Counsel, of Chicago (Daniel Pascale and Edmund Hatfield, Assistant Corporation Counsel, and Maureen Kelly, law student, of counsel), for appellants.

Nolan, O'Malley and Dunne, of Chicago (Patrick W. Dunne and Michael J. Fogarty, of counsel), for appellees.


Order reversed.

Mr. JUSTICE JIGANTI delivered the opinion of the court:

The plaintiffs, Robert and Lillian Wordell, owned two adjoining lots in the City of Chicago, Illinois, which they divided into three lots. They applied for a building permit from the City of Chicago to construct a house on one of the lots resulting from this division. The city, through its commissioner of buildings, Joseph T.
